Lee:
"En aquel tiempo, Jesús dijo a los judíos: “Yo me voy y ustedes me buscarán, pero morirán en su pecado. A donde yo voy, ustedes no pueden venir”. Dijeron entonces los judíos: “¿Estará pensando en suicidarse y por eso nos dice: ‘A donde yo voy, ustedes no pueden venir’?” Pero Jesús añadió: “Ustedes son de aquí abajo y yo soy de allá arriba; ustedes son de este mundo, yo no soy de este mundo. Se lo acabo de decir: morirán en sus pecados, porque si no creen que Yo Soy, morirán en sus pecados.” (Juan 8, 21-24)
Reflexiona:
"Señor Jesús, tú que me has revelado que eres el enviado del Padre. Ayúdame a volver siempre mis ojos a tu rostro y recordar así su gran amor."
Amén
